Whether it’s a base game, a stand-alone game, or an expansion.

Many games have add-ons, which means you have to have the base game to play. You don’t need the expansions, though, to play the base game.

For example, Flash Point has a few add-ons, such as Extreme Danger, 2nd Storey, and Urban Structures, but you can still play the game without them.

Some games, like Sheriff of Nottingham, are “standalone,” which means they don’t have any add-ons or need anything else to play.

An expansion for Catan for 5 or 6 players. To use this expansion, you need the original Catan game.

What are The Different Types of Best Board Games For College Students?

The different types of board games for college students are-

Deck building games

In deck building or builder games, you use cards to “build” your hand or deck as you play. It’s not always as simple as it sounds, but it’s always fun and different. It is one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.

Co-operative games

In co-operative games, you and your teammates (sometimes all of them, sometimes just a few) work together to win. Think of the game (or the board) as another player who is trying to beat you by changing and growing.

Some people say that these games are like video games where the board is the last boss you have to beat. Co-operative games are one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.

Party Games

Party games are mostly made for big groups and are often played by two teams against each other. They get played in rounds, and the goal is to get the most points to win.

These are great for loud, competitive people who want to have a lot of fun and laughs. Most of the time, there isn’t much strategy in these games.

Two-players board games

Games for two players get changed or made so that only two people can play. Some games, like 7 Wonders, let you make a “ghost” third player so that two people can play together. The two-players board game is one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.

Other games, like 7 Wonders Duel, are only meant for two players. Unlike other games for two or more people, the two-player games don’t get bigger as more people join in. These can be fun games for two people to play.

Have you seen: Top 15 Best Electric Scooters For College Students | 2022 Ranking

One-player board games

Like two-player games, these games get changed or made so that only one person can play. The difference is that there aren’t many games for just one person, but you can play many games by yourself, especially cooperative games. This is one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.

These games are great for people who want to start playing board games. However, they don’t have time to get together with a group or just like to challenge themselves.

Again, you can use these instead of video games. Friday and Agricola are two good examples of this (1-5 players).

Board Games with Cards and Dice

From Yahtzee and Go Fish, these games use dice and cards to help you reach your goal. Whether that’s getting the most points or killing off other players to be the last one standing. Bang!

The Dice Game and Exploding Kittens are a couple of examples. Board games with cards and dice are one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.

Board games with cards

The players can choose which cards they want to pick or use in the game. This can come from a common pile instead of getting drawn at random, from a set of cards in their hand that they will pass on to another player after choosing one, or somewhere in between.

Some of these games can be with or without a board. Board games with cards are one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.

#5. Rummikub

Rummikub doesn’t look like much, but it’s one of my favorite games to play with friends. The goal is to be the first person to get rid of all your tile pieces.

You can do this by making groups of numbers that go in order (2, 3, 4) or groups of numbers that are all the same (5, 5, 5).

You can build or even take tiles from sets that have already been generally put down. Rummikub is a fun and challenging game for the mind that keeps people like me coming back for more. It is one of the mind-tasking board games for college students.
